Book Description
A search for squarks and gluinos is performed in the topology of multijet events accompanied by large missing transverse energy in 2.1fb−1 of p{bar p} collision data collected using the D0 detector at the Fermilab Tevatron Collider at a center of mass energy of 1.96 TeV. About half of this dataset is specifically analyzed for events involving at least one tau lepton decaying hadronically in addition. No deviation from the Standard Model expectation is observed and the analyses are combined to set limits on the squark and gluino masses and on parameters of minimal supergravity.

Book Description
We report on D0 searches for scalar quarks ({tilde q}) and gluinos ({tilde g}), the superpartners of quark and gluons, in topologies involving jets and missing transverse energies. Data samples obtained with D0 detector from p{bar p} collisions at a center-of-mass energy of 1.96 TeV corresponding to an integrated luminosities of 1-4 fb−1 were analyzed. No evidence for the production of such particles were observed and lower limits on squarks and gluino masses were set.

Book Description
Based on 7.1 pb−1 of single interaction event data collected by the DO Detector at Fermilab during the 1992--1993 p{bar p} collider run at (square root)s = 1.8 TeV, results are presented of a search for supersymmetric partners of the quark and gluon, the squark and gluino, using missing E{sub T} and jets as the signature. Limits are set on the squark and gluino masses in the context of the Minimal Supersymmetric Standard Model including the effect of cascade decays of the squark and gluino.

Book Description
We report on a search for squarks and gluinos in p{anti p} collisions at (square root) s= 1.8 TeV using the D0 detector at Fermilab. Data corresponding to 79.2 " 4.2 pb−1 were examined for events with large missing transverse energy, three or more jets, and the absence of isolated leptons. No events were observed significantly in excess of Standard Model background predictions, and we place limits on the Minimal Supergravity parameters M0 and M12.
